A simple principle sits beneath the way we operate: the firm that manages your capital should not be the firm that holds or lends against it. That separation protects you, and it keeps our judgement clean.
Your capital remains with your own bank or qualified custodian. We never hold or commingle client assets; we direct, we do not take possession.
One clear and impartial view of your wealth across your existing accounts and managers, reported by a party with nothing to sell you.
You deal with the people who actually manage your capital, not a call centre or a rotating relationship manager.
Where specialist breadth is needed, we introduce and coordinate with selected third parties, rather than steering you to anything of our own.
We take no deposits, issue no cards or payments, and provide no lending or Lombard facilities. We do not act as a currency counterparty; currency exposure is managed as a portfolio risk. These are deliberate choices, not gaps, and they are what independence looks like in practice.
We are independent and privately held, by structure rather than slogan. We manufacture no products of our own, carry no proprietary book to fill, and have no cross-sell to make. Our counsel therefore answers to one party, the client, and to no one else.
Because we are not a bank, there is no pressure to place deposits, to push financing, or to steer your assets toward a captive custodian. We are paid to steward your capital, not to transact upon it, and that alignment is verifiable: our Capital Markets Services Licence and the absence of any in-house product are matters of record, not adjectives.
